Fortitude is located in a cobbled alley in Bloomsbury, around the block from the Russell Square tube stop. It is identified by the tall, deep blue doors and the small white sign, plus the small crowd gathered out front on a couple of benches.

Enter the doors and you’ll find a warm and bustling bakery. Trays of fresh pasta welcome you, while beyond them the team rushes to knead dough, fill beignets, remove trays from ovens, fill savory fillings and wrap sandwiches. You will be greeted warmly and asked for your order.

The selection rotates daily, but based on our 5-6 visits (yes, over the course of our eight days in town), we think it’s safe to say you can’t go wrong with anything you choose—sweet or savory.




Savory puff pastries and scones rotated with fillings like cheese and red pepper, feta and spinach, cheese and leek.

Some are stuffed with sausage and vegetables.

One day we tried this beautiful chicken salad sandwich loaded with grilled chicken and veggies.

The shop also features a full espresso bar. As you place your order, you’ll be prompted for a coffee and tea selection before heading to the end of the line.

They’ll wrap your cakes to go, and you can take them with you, find a seat on the benches outside, or just stand in the alley and have a party.



All the pies are very reasonably priced, especially considering the quality, and very filling. Check out these sausage rolls!


We went back many times to the chocolate cinnamon rolls and the jam and custard filled morning rolls.


Here’s that chicken salad sandwich again and one of the stuffed beignets.

On one of our weekend visits they presented a lovely croque madame with bacon, cheese and a golden egg yolk in a savory puff pastry.

Fortitude is open seven days a week, starting at 7:30 a.m. on weekdays and 8:30 a.m. on weekends. Expect a bit of a queue on weekends. We noticed that the shop was popular with many cycling groups that came in droves.
